Estimation of the Probability Density Parameters of the Interval Duration Between Events in Correlated Semi-synchronous Event Flow of the Second Order by the Method of Moments

Abstract:

We consider a correlated semi-synchronous event flow of the second order with two states; it is one of the mathematical models for an incoming stream of claims (events) in modern digital integral servicing networks, telecommunication systems and satellite communication networks. We solve the problem of estimating the probability density parameters of the values of the interval duration between the moments of the events occurrence by the method of moments for general and special cases of setting the flow parameters. The results of statistical experiments performed on a flow simulation model are given.
